Requirements
  • 15+ years experience planning, managing, and growing large health plan accounts. preferably with experience in both the commercial and Medicare Advantage/Medicaid populations
  • Ability to work cross-functionally and build consensus with internal and external stakeholders in support of strategic account objectives
  • 8+ years experience in conceptual sales of population health management services to plans (Behavioral Health is desired.)
  • Proven track record of exceeding revenue and client satisfaction goals within a large health plan
  • Ownership of the P&L for a book of business with responsibility for annual contracting activities, to include ASO and risk pricing with appropriate profitability standards by the operations teams along with renewals and up-sell opportunities
  • Solid understanding of the financial implications of Account Management strategies and tactics, including Pricing and Risk Sharing
  • Effective in navigating the organization and knowing the opportunities and challenges and how to navigate the organization
  • Ability to communicate and work with clinical and product teams for new ideas generation, program roll-outs, and problem resolution
  • Ability to initiate and cultivate meaningful, productive relationships at all levels of an account including leadership
  • Experience communicating and collaborating with internal constituents to secure resources and talent
  • Ability to plan, execute, measure results and drive improvement on a continuous basis
  • Strategic thinking and ability to communicate on every level of the client organization
  • Ability to serve as leader/mentor in complex and rapidly shifting environment
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
Responsibilities
  • Drive strategic growth and development within new and existing/lines of business to align AbleTo and clients' strategies and goals
  • Lead strategy for revenue growth across client
  • Identify and prioritize mutually beneficial opportunities to increase account revenue. Opportunities include: expanding current programs to reach new populations - e.g., Care Delivery Organizations; Medicaid, etc.; increasing engagement with and enrollment of currently targeted populations; and suggesting and helping to develop new product/pricing configurations, in collaboration with and approved by AbleTo's Finance team
  • Construct and deliver on a strategic account-level business plan, with projected revenue and tactics required for success
  • Drive account satisfaction and client retention
  • Lead development of best practices across the Enterprise Growth team and collaborate with Senior leaders on how AbleTo is representing itself in the market
  • Understand, quantify and present AbleTo programs in order to drive new opportunities and increase the level of satisfaction
  • Increase AbleTo's awareness and relevance with key account stakeholders by identifying, developing, and deploying mutually beneficial opportunities to raise the account/AbleTo partnership through peer-reviewed studies, press opportunities, industry and client events, training, etc
  • Serve as liaison in internal and external meetings related to product, compliance, data/engineering, and marketing
